개발자 Q&A

개발하다 막혔다면? 여기서 질문하세요! 초보부터 고수까지, 함께 고민하고 해결하는 공간입니다. 누구나 자유롭게 질문하고 답변을 남겨보세요!

2025.03.14 10:27

cubrid_unbuffered_query 함수에 대한 이해가 필요합니다.

  • 노드장인 2일 전 2025.03.14 10:27
  • 4
    1
저는 현재 cubrid_unbuffered_query 함수를 사용하여 쿼리를 실행 중입니다.
하지만 쿼리 결과를 처리하는 부분에서 어려움을 겪고 있습니다.
쿼리 결과를 처리하는 함수를 호출하는 방법에 대해 알려주실 수 있나요?

또한, cubrid_unbuffered_query 함수의 사용시 주의점에 대해 알려주실 수 있나요?

예를 들어, 쿼리 결과를 처리하는 함수를 호출하는 경우, 쿼리 결과를 처리하기 전에, query_result 변수에 쿼리 결과를 저장해야 한다고 들었습니다.
이러한 방법은 올바른 방법일까요?

    댓글목록

    profile_image
    나우호스팅  2일 전



    cubrid_unbuffered_query 함수는 쿼리를 실행하여 결과를 가져올 때, 결과를 버퍼에 저장하지 않고 바로 결과를 처리할 수 있도록 해줍니다.

    쿼리 결과를 처리하는 함수를 호출하는 방법은 다음과 같습니다.

    1. 쿼리 결과를 처리하기 전에, query_result 변수에 쿼리 결과를 저장해야 합니다.

    #hostingforum.kr
    php
    
    $result = cubrid_unbuffered_query("SELECT * FROM 테이블명", $conn);
    
    

    2. 쿼리 결과를 처리하는 함수를 호출하여 결과를 처리합니다.
    #hostingforum.kr
    php
    
    while ($row = cubrid_fetch_assoc($result)) {
    
        // 쿼리 결과를 처리하는 코드
    
    }
    
    

    또는
    #hostingforum.kr
    php
    
    while ($row = cubrid_fetch_array($result)) {
    
        // 쿼리 결과를 처리하는 코드
    
    }
    
    

    또는
    #hostingforum.kr
    php
    
    while ($row = cubrid_fetch_row($result)) {
    
        // 쿼리 결과를 처리하는 코드
    
    }
    
    


    cubrid_unbuffered_query 함수의 사용시 주의점은 다음과 같습니다.

    1. 쿼리 결과를 처리하기 전에, query_result 변수에 쿼리 결과를 저장해야 합니다.
    2. 쿼리 결과를 처리하는 함수를 호출할 때, 결과를 처리하기 전에, 결과를 저장해야 합니다.
    3. 쿼리 결과를 처리하는 함수를 호출할 때, 결과를 처리하기 전에, 결과를 저장해야 합니다.
    4. 쿼리 결과를 처리하는 함수를 호출할 때, 결과를 처리하기 전에, 결과를 저장해야 합니다.

    예를 들어, 쿼리 결과를 처리하는 함수를 호출하는 경우, 쿼리 결과를 처리하기 전에, query_result 변수에 쿼리 결과를 저장해야 합니다.

    #hostingforum.kr
    php
    
    $result = cubrid_unbuffered_query("SELECT * FROM 테이블명", $conn);
    
    while ($row = cubrid_fetch_assoc($result)) {
    
        // 쿼리 결과를 처리하는 코드
    
    }
    
    


    이러한 방법은 올바른 방법입니다.

    2025-03-14 10:28

  • 개발자 Q&A 포인트 정책
      글쓰기
      50P
      댓글
      10P
  • 전체 3,871건 / 39 페이지

검색

게시물 검색